          !

          [Boolean Operators]

          Description

          Logical NOT results in a true if the operand is false and vice versa.

          Example Code

          This operator can be used inside the condition of an if statement.

          if (!x) { // if x is not true  // statements}

          It can be used to invert the boolean value.

          x = !y; // the inverted value of y is stored in x

          Notes and Warnings

          The bitwise not ~ (tilde) looks much different than the boolean not ! (exclamation point or "bang" as the programmers say) but you still have to be sure which one you want where.
